Help Our Urban Youth, Donate a Computer

Help Now Consulting announced plans to assist the Brotherly Love Urban Youth Services, located at 5619 Germantown Avenue, 2nd Floor, Phila., PA., to develop and acquire donations for its revitalized Computer Learning Center. Help Now will be Partnering with M.T. Fiore & Associates to help the founder of Brotherly Love Urban Youth Services, Pastor Bryan Robinson, revitalize the after-school facility to provide basic computer instruction.

The new Computer Learning Program will be a center for basic technical development including but not limited to office productivity, learning aides, reference tools, and basic computer training. William Picardi, President of Help Now, stated, "We are pleased to assist Pastor Robinson in his efforts to teach young adults and mentor them in basic technical skills. It is an opportunity for Help Now to give back to the community and we look forward to taking part in the program."

Help Now will not only be donating their efforts to acquire and establish the computer learning center but have agreed to donate their time to Lecture in the Tutorial Series this fall. Pastor Bryan Robinson stated, "It is truly an honor and a blessing to work with Help Now and M.T. Fiore & Associates. The volunteering of their time and effort to help us get PC's and equipment for a new computer learning center can truly effect, enrich and change the lives of the young people in the urban community. Working side by side with these two company's will show our young people that someone does care about their future. This really is a great moment for our community, we are truly blessed."

To donate a computer just call our Client Support Center at 888-HELP 678 and inform us when and where the equipment will be available. We will come pick it up at your convenience. All donations will be considered charitable donations to a registered Non-Profit 5013c. Help Now will provide the appropriate documentation to any clients willing to donate functional PC's, printers, and network devices to Brotherly Love Urban Youth Services.

Onsite versus Remote Support

We asked in our Client Survey, What your preferred method of response to service requests is and received a 60% onsite response. We are pleased that you find our engineers polite and professional (96 and 94 survey scores). However, onsite response delays a solution to the issue and costs significantly more to provide in both down time and cost to deliver for our clients. Imagine if your server hosting a business critical application is not functioning, it is 2PM and you call in a request for onsite support, all our engineers are currently deployed and we inform you we will be onsite tomorrow at 10AM. Your entire business is effected by this issue costing lost productivity and poor client perception. The alternative is you call in and we respond no problem, we will remote in and take a look immediately and then solve the issue with minimal disruption to your business. Responding remotely allows a quick response with a resolution the majority of the time. Saving money and productivity.
